New support staff should read the Velmora stale-cache postmortem from last quarter. Short version: the Brimway edge cache served expired pricing for six hours because invalidation messages were dropped during a broker restart. Customers saw old totals at checkout. If a similar report comes in, check cache-age headers before escalating. The full postmortem, timeline, and action items are on the internal page below.

wiki page, tahaf-tajog: https://jira.ordindyn.corp/pipeline

## Service Accounts — StormFan Alert Fan-Out

The fan-out worker authenticates to the internal dispatch tier using the svc-stormfan account. Rotate quarterly; scopes are limited to publish-only on alert topics. If deliveries stall during your shift, verify the worker is using the current credential, reproduced below for reference.

API key for kaweg-hahif: kto4_rAjZ

**CI note: Graphlark visualizer job timing out.** The dependency-graph render step chokes on repos with more than ~2k edges; the layout pass isn't parallelized yet. Quick fix: set the depth cap to 4 in the pipeline config and rerun. Upstream fix lands next sprint. Known-good build token follows below.

build token for tawip-yageg: htk9_92ac43d42